What are the main types of preschool options available in Zalma, Missouri?

In a small, rural community like Zalma, options typically include in-home licensed daycare providers that offer preschool curriculum, faith-based programs often associated with local churches, and potentially a public school early childhood program through the Zalma R-V School District. Due to the town's size, many families also consider providers in nearby larger towns like Marble Hill or Jackson for more structured programs.

How much does preschool typically cost in Zalma, MO?

Costs can vary significantly. Licensed in-home providers may charge $100-$150 per week, while part-time church-based programs can be more affordable, sometimes under $50 per week. Missouri offers financial assistance through the DESE Early Childhood Special Education and the DSS Child Care Subsidy program for eligible families, which can be crucial for accessing services in this area.

What should I look for to ensure a preschool or daycare in Zalma is safe and licensed?

First, verify the provider is licensed by the Missouri Department of Health and Senior Services (DHSS). You can check this online or ask the provider directly. Visit the location to observe cleanliness, safe outdoor play areas, and ask about staff-to-child ratios and background checks. In a close-knit community like Zalma, also seek personal recommendations from other parents.

Are there any free public preschool programs available for Zalma residents?

The Zalma R-V School District may offer early childhood special education services for children with identified delays at no cost. For general education, free public preschool is not universally available in Missouri, but the district might participate in the Missouri Preschool Program (MPP) or Title I, offering limited slots based on need. Contact the district superintendent's office directly for the most current information.

What are the enrollment timelines and key considerations for securing a preschool spot in Zalma?

Due to limited options, it's advisable to start inquiring 6-12 months in advance, especially for the most sought-after in-home providers. Many programs follow a traditional school year calendar. Key considerations include the provider's daily schedule aligning with your work needs, their transportation policies (as most will not provide transport), and their philosophy on play-based versus academic learning.
